BOSTON – UVM field hockey graduate student goalkeeper
Sierra Espeland picked up her first America East Weekly award of the season Tuesday. The league announced it's weekly award recipients and Espeland received the Defensive Player of the Week nod.

Espeland posted a 2-0 record last week with a 0.48 goals against average, seven saves and a .875 save percentage.
She earned her first shutout of the season and 10
th of her career with Sunday's 1-0 victory over Stanford. She made six saves in that contest including one on a penalty stroke and several down a key stretch at the end of regulation to help send the game to overtime where the Cats picked up the league victory.
Earlier this season Espeland became Vermont's all-time leader in wins and continues to add to that mark as she has now backboned the longest win streak in program history.
UVM plays host to the newest member of America East – Bryant – on Friday afternoon before heading to Northeastern to close out the weekend set.
